National Day for Truth and Reconciliation
We look forward to Monday, September 30th, National Day for Truth and Reconciliation. We will continue to learn and grow with a lens on Indigenous perspectives, both historical and current. One of our important school goals is:
We will honour our commitment to Truth and Reconciliation by nurturing respectful and reciprocal relationships among Indigenous Peoples and Treaty Partners, and by cultivating intergenerational healing and wellness in a restorative education system.
Wearing an orange shirt on Monday is one way of symbolizing our commitment.
Our Land Acknowledgement, created by former students of Ancaster Meadow, and read each morning by students is:
“At Ancaster Meadow, we recognize that we are on the traditional land of the Anishinaabe and Haudenosaunee, and that we’ve made an agreement represented by the Dish With One Spoon Treaty Wampum Belt to share and take care of the land and the water with a good mind and a good heart. We say the Land Acknowledgement to help us remember our responsibilities and the history of the Anishinaabe and Haudenosaunee people who were here long before settlers arrived. We must respect our environment, and we must treat others the way we want to be treated.”
